What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Access-A-Ride Driver,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Access-A-Ride Driver, you need a valid commercial driver’s license (CDL), a clean driving record, and knowledge of accessibility regulations. Familiarity with GPS navigation, scheduling software, and wheelchair lift operation is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, patience, and a commitment to customer service help drivers assist passengers with diverse needs. These competencies ensure safe, reliable, and compassionate transportation for individuals with disabilities or mobility challenges.

What is Access-A-Ride?

Access-A-Ride is a paratransit service provided by the Metropolitan Transportation Authority (MTA) in New York City for individuals with disabilities who are unable to use regular public transportation. The service offers shared-ride, door-to-door transportation for eligible riders, ensuring they can travel within the city and nearby areas. Riders must apply and be approved based on specific eligibility criteria related to their disability. The program is designed to promote independence and equal access to transportation for all residents.

AECOM is seeking a proven Program Management professional to lead the Regional Transportation Commission's Club Ride program.
About Club Ride: Club Ride works with the business community, regional stakeholders and residents to reduce traffic congestion and travel emissions in Southern Nevada. The program provides education, services and promotions that encourage the use of transit, active transportation, carpooling and vanpooling as a means to improve quality of live in the community.
AECOM is responsible for the comprehensive management of Club Ride. This includes an outreach team responsible for developing community relationships and maintaining a network of employer and community partners that implement commute options programs. In this role the person will also provide oversight to a multi-disciplinary team of subconsultants that fulfill regional marketing and communications along with specialized strategies to expand the program's reach and impact.
